44th SSA Call for Papers
The Semiotics of Borders and the Borders of Semiotics The SSA 44th Annual Conference Portland, Oregon, USA, October 9–13, 2019 This year’s Conference theme: “The Semiotics of Borders and the Borders of Semiotics” speaks to the limit conditions of systems of all sorts. As well, it poses both broad and specific questions of ontology and epistemology…

SSA Yearbook: Call for Submissions
The SSA announces its call for submissions to the next volume of the Yearbook, Semiotics 2018: Signs of Resilience. The Yearbook seeks 3,000-to-6,000-word submissions from current SSA members–including 2018 SSA Conference participants–based on scholarly work completed during the past year. Contributions should be accessible to a broad interdisciplinary readership, but focused on some aspect of…
